Travertine Tiles: Natural Warmth and Texture
Travertine offers a completely different, yet equally beautiful, aesthetic. Formed by natural mineral springs, travertine tiles display rich earthy tones ranging from soft ivory to deep walnut. This natural color palette complements both modern and rustic interiors.
Travertine tile flooring is particularly valued for its textured surface, which provides grip while maintaining a soft, inviting feel underfoot. Finishes such as honed, brushed, or tumbled enhance its organic charm. Whether used indoors or outdoors, travertine creates a warm and grounded atmosphere that ages gracefully over time.
Because of its resilience and slip resistance, travertine is an ideal choice for kitchens, pool areas, patios, and bathrooms. It stands up to daily wear while maintaining a refined, natural appearance.

Long-Term Value and Care
Beyond beauty, marble and travertine are built to last. When properly sealed and maintained, they can endure for decades. Regular cleaning with pH-neutral products helps preserve the surface and prevents staining. Sealing the tiles once or twice a year protects them from moisture, ensuring that they retain their luxurious appearance for generations.
